Quick answer
助 is the kanji for "to help". It is a JLPT N3 kanji. The main reading is たす.ける (tasukeru). Stroke-order practice is available below.
Meaning
to help
Also : to rescue · to assist

Example Sentences
困ったときは助け合いましょう。
こまったときはたすけあいましょう。
Let's help each other when we're in trouble.
先輩に助けてもらいました。
せんぱいにたすけてもらいました。
I was helped by my senior.
